About painting & decorating
The visible part of decorating is the last coat. The part that decides how it looks in two years is everything before it — filling, sanding, caulking, sealing new plaster properly rather than putting emulsion straight onto it.
That is where most of our time on a decorating job goes, and it is the difference between a room that still looks crisp at the skirting and one that does not.

Can you decorate after building work?
Yes, and it's usually the right sequence — new plaster needs to dry and then be sealed properly before it's painted.
